> > the driver message _is_ implemented on all platforms.
> > that's the entire idea of the plugin architecture, to get away from
> > platform constraints.
> >
> > the _only_ problem right now is the autobuild process, that currently
> > disables the plugin system on OSX, and instead uses the old fixed system
> > (hence no "driver" message).
> >
> > so the prboelm is a trivial one (though it has to be solved).
